Without battery backup your solar power goes to the grid, and you get credit for it, so you do save money. But without battery back up, when the grid goes down you have no power. If your panels feed your home directly, and doesn't go directly to the grid, then in an outage you have power only while it is daylight.

I thought Texas was hot, desert like. Maybe I'm misremembering all those cowboy films. And Dallas the TV series with JR Ewing.
Depends on the region of Texas. It’s definitely hot here, but parts of Texas are very wooded and yes some parts arid. Terrain goes from hilly to relatively flat just depends on the region. Houston area is relatively flat, but plenty of trees. It’s old sea bottom basically.
